The Bosch Rexroth Indramat 2AD160C-B35RB1-BS03-C2N1, part of the 2AD 3-Phase Induction Motors, is an AC servo motor with a 160 mm frame size and B35 flange mounting. It features a resolver feedback system and rated power of 10.1 kW. The motor has external blower cooling and offers IP65 protection excluding the shaft end and blower.

The 2AD160C-B35RB1-BS03-C2N1 belongs to the 2AD series that is recognized for its application in industrial automation. The 2AD160C is an AC induction motor developed by Bosch Rexroth Indramat. It is designed with an axial blower for cooling and is classified under vibration grade R.
The 160 is the size code of the motor with a length code C that defines the dimensional standard. The shaft is a smooth type equipped with a shaft seal, and the motor does not include a shaft end on side B. The motor is wound with the BS code that specifies the electrical configuration. The power connection is directed to side B with a terminal box arrangement that is positioned on the right when viewed from the shaft end. The 2AD160C-B35RB1-BS03-C2N1 AC induction motor is equipped with a flange and foot mounting system, which offers installation flexibility. A motor feedback system with high resolution is integrated into the motor, which facilitates precise control. It operates without a holding brake and incorporates standard bearings for reliable mechanical function. Within an ambient temperature range of 0 to 40 °C, the motor is intended to function. These features allow the motor to deliver efficient and consistent performance across different automation applications.
With a moment of inertia of 0.229 kgm2, the rotor makes sure that the acceleration and deceleration specifications are set correctly. It will function properly provided that the temperature surrounding the 2AD160C-B35RB1-BS03-C2N1 motor remains within the specified range. Using the motor's thermal time constant of 65 minutes, one can figure out how much heat the motor can handle when it is constantly loaded.
